Liverpool (2nd EPL)
Played 3 with 7 points
Could this be Liverpool's year and finally bring home the championship that they have wanted since 1990. For me the answer is no as while I do think Liverpool have a good team I don’t think they have as good as a team as either Manchester United or Chelsea but they have started the season well enough and are unbeaten in the first three games of the season.
Now the problem for me at the moment is that whenever I’ve seen Liverpool this season they have not been all that convincing, they huffed and puffed when I saw them at the Stadium of Light and for me while being the better team where lucky to come away with three points. It also took two very late goals to overcome Boro at Anfield and they have also taken a point away at Villa. When you also consider the Champions League where they struggled to get past Standard Liege then it does make you wonder how they are unbeaten so far.
Yet people say that teams that win titles have to win games when not playing all that well and at the moment this could be Liverpool as like I’ve said they are unbeaten without playing very well so could this be their year? I still don’t think so but this game will go a long way to showing the rest of the league if Liverpool should be feared this season as a team that could go all the way.
Manchester United (9th EPL)
Played 2 with 4 points
With playing in the Super Cup, Manchester United have played one less game than everyone else in the league (ex Fulham of course) and are also unbeaten in the league. You always know what you are going to get with Manchester United and that is a team who you know will be there abouts come the end of the season and I fully expect them to be in the top two again come the end of this season.
So far this season they have played Newcastle at home and drew 1-1 and were far from convincing and they went away to Portsmouth and won 1-0 and at the moment this does seem a team with a lack of goals. Of course when you take Ronaldo out of the team it has to leave a gap, and United will be hoping that new signing Berbatov will make a big difference.
As usual this is a massive game for United and I guess for some united fans the biggest game of the season and again like Liverpool they will be able to use this game, as a guide to see how they feel the rest of the season will go.
Head to Head
You have to go back to November 2001 for the last time Liverpool beat Manchester United at Anfield and that is one cracking proud record United hold over their rivals. Liverpool have not even scored in their last three home games v United so the stats seem to prove one thing and that is quite simply Manchester Untied rule this fixture at the moment.
